2019 Knights Bridge Sauvignon Blanc Knights Valley Pont De Chevalier                
Price: $49.50       Sale $43.56
Only 150 cases produced of this Pont de Chevalier fresh melon and fig like fruit with notes of white flowers and very rich and seductive bouquet.  Fat and juicy on the tongue with a smooth creamy texture leaving the tongue salivating for food very refreshing and rich at the same time.  Finish 45+     Excellent +         

2018 Knights Bridge Estate Chardonnay Knights Valley
Price: $27.00       Sale $23.76
A good amount of ripe tree fruit lemon drop candy with a hint of green pea like note here cooler climate chardonnay with a hint of lightly toasted oak spice.  A bright and zesty style of Chardonnay with just a kiss of lightly toasted oak spice only 10 months in oak and a bright refreshing finish a nice touch for briny mineral nuance at the end nicely balanced.  Finish                 Excellent             

2016 Knights Bridge Estate Cabernet Sauvignon Knights Valley
Price: $66.00       Sale $58.08
A good amount of dark currant and black plum fruit here with notes of dark earth and dark chocolate a little Merlot 4% in the Cabernet Sauvignon with a full-bodied bouquet.  A big and chewy Cabernet on the tongue with lots of everything here smooth tannins and nice freshness on the finish.  Finish 40+        Excellent             

2016 Knights Bridge Cabernet Sauvignon Knights Valley              
Price: $123.00    Sale $108.24

A dissimilar bouquet to the Estate only 210 cases produced and there is quite a different level of concentration and richness here and a peppery spice a bit more toasty oak spice, dark currant and plum fruit and this is 100% varietal with lots of everything.  A big and chewy wine with lots of ripe round tannins and multiple layers of fruit, earth and spice and dark coco very long and layered wine on the finish.  Finish 50+             Most Excellent

The Knights Bridge Story:
See the source image
In 2006, several close-knit family members discovered 50 acres of hillside vineyards in Knights Valley, the perfect spot to produce exceptional Sauvignon Blanc, Chardonnay and Cabernet Sauvignon. Knights Bridge vineyard is nestled on the pristine west side of Knights Valley, the warmest appellation in Sonoma County. It was here that the family decided to create Knights Bridge Winery with the singular goal of producing world-class wines. Joining on their quest is a group of talented professionals, all striving together in the pursuit of excellence from sustainable farming methods and small lot wine production to unique tasting experiences. Knights Bridge Winery is guided by a deep respect for nature, a passion for fine wines, and a dedication to family and friends.

The Knights Bridge vineyard is located on the southern boundary of the stunning Knights Valley AVA of Sonoma County. Rising from 300 to 900 feet in elevation on the rocky slopes of the Mayacamas mountain range north of Calistoga, Knights Bridge Vineyard overlooks a spectacular display of rolling hills, steep mountains and gentle valleys. Cool wind from the Pacific blows through the gap in these mountains, providing the grapes with longer hang time to develop richer flavors. Blessed with a combination of iron-rich and white-ash tufa (calcium carbonate) soils, the terroir of Knights Bridge, combining the perfect blend of climate and location, provides an ideal environment for the chardonnay, cabernet sauvignon and sauvignon blanc vines to thrive. Taking a sustainable approach, these carefully farmed hillsides share open space with wildlife habitats and riparian corridors, helping preserve nature's delicate balance.

A bit about the Winemaker:
In 1988, Douglas Danielak began crafting wines for some of the most admired wineries in Sonoma and Napa counties, and in 2006 was named an original member of our winemaking team. Having made exceptional wines from our estate vineyards for over 10 years, he is now our Director of Winemaking.

Douglas graduated from Michigan State University, and later U.C. Davis earning a BS in Viticulture and Enology.  He also attended the Lycée Agricole et Viticole de Beaune in Burgundy. During his time in France, Douglas worked with Rebecca Wasserman at Le Serbet gaining in-depth knowledge of barrels from cooperages Francois Frères and Taransaud.  During his award-winning career, Douglas has received both critical praise and high scores. In 2014, Wine Spectator named Douglas a Winemaker to Watch.
